Medium: vencendo paywalls
O site Medium é uma plataforma online para publicação de textos de diversos temas e formatos. Ele foi criado pelos cofundadores do Twitter, Evan Williams e Biz Stone, em 2012.
O Medium se diferencia de outros sites de blogs por ter um estilo mais social, informal e colaborativo, onde os leitores podem interagir com os escritores, seguir suas publicações, recomendar e comentar as histórias.
Gosto muito do conteúdo e aprendo muita coisa por meio da leitura dos artigos do Medium.
Contudo, por se tratar de conteudo que é monetizado, para a leitura é necessário pagar taxas. Como há muita informação bacana no Medium estive buscando alternativas para “furar” o paywall.
Por algum tempo usei a extensão Medium Unlimited. Contudo, ela deixou de funcionar.
12ft.io
Após isso encontrei o site 12ft.io, que é um serviço que permite acessar gratuitamente páginas da web que bloqueiam a leitura pública por meio de paywalls. Ele funciona adicionando o prefixo 12ft.io/
a qualquer URL protegida por um paywall, e mostrando a versão em cache, sem o muro, da página.
O site foi criado por dois estudantes de ciência da computação que acreditam que o Google Adwords prejudicou a qualidade da informação na web. O site também oferece uma extensão para Chrome e Firefox que facilita o uso do serviço.
Bookmarklet
Após compreender que basta acrescentar um prefixo ao site do Medium para que ele renderize o conteúdo, decidi usar um Bookmarklet to edit current URL.
Um bookmarklet é um pequeno programa que é armazenado como um favorito no navegador do usuário. Ele contém um código JavaScript que pode ser executado em qualquer página da web, realizando alguma ação ou modificação na página.
Por exemplo, um bookmarklet pode enviar a página atual para um serviço de tradução, alterar o tamanho ou a cor da fonte, destacar palavras-chave, etc.
Os bookmarklets são úteis para automatizar tarefas comuns ou personalizar a experiência do usuário na web.
Apenas para entender como funciona: crie um bookmark no navegador apontando para a seguinte “URL”:
javascript: (() => {
return '<h1 style="color: white; background-color: black;">Hello, World!</h1>';
})();
Clique! Entendeu como funciona?! Em resumo: é possível rodar funções em javascript usando um bookmark!
Agora basta indicar uma função na qual ele pegue o conteúdo da URL e acrescente o prefixo 12ft.io/
!
javascript: (function () {
window.location = window.location
.toString()
.replace("https://", "https://12ft.io/");
})();
Dessa forma, ao chegar em um site que tenha paywall, basta clicar no bookmark que ela fura o paywall, obtendo a versão em cache da página.
PS: Também funciona no site da Folha de São Paulo e deve funcionar em qualquer paywall!
Freedium.cfd
Em 18.11.2023 notei que não estava mais funcionando o 12ft. Pesquisando no forum do Reddit, sobre How can I read Medium articles for free as something change recently and not single browser extension is working for me?, encontrei a anterativa que também funciona como bookmarklet.
Deixe um comentário